A Strategic HR Plan is
essential to align an organisation’s resources to its mission,
vision, values and strategies.
The Strategic HR Plan will detail the role that Human Resources will
play in supporting the goals and strategies of the organisation. It
will
ensure that all aspects of Human Resources are focused towards
obtaining the success of the Corporation's Long-Term Strategy and
Key Performance Indicators.
A Strategic HR Plan is also necessary to meet the expectations
and requirements of corporate governance, transparency, work ethics,
corporate values and profitability through the definition of the
various
functions, processes and procedures needed to execute the strategy.
Strategic HR Planning will enable the organisation to identify the
HR gaps between present capabilities and the future requirements and
how they will be achieved. It will ensure that the organisation has
the right people, with the right skills, in the right place, at the
right time to carry out the strategy.
